DC Shoes/Founders

DC Shoes is an American company that specializes in footwear for extreme sports, skateboarding, snowboarding as well as snowboards, shirts, jeans, hats, and jackets. The company was founded in 1993 by Ken Block and Damon Way, and is based in Vista, California.

What does the brand name DC Shoes mean?

Originally Answered: What does the brand name DC Shoes mean? DC stands for Droor’s Clothing. This was the original name of the company when it was established in 1994. However, the company was eventually sold, and hence, the name Droor’s Clothing has been dropped. It was eventually changed to simply DC.

How big is the size of DC Shoes?

In October 1994, as a sign of a growing business, DC moved into a new facility, which has a size of 16,000 square feet. It was also during such year when Clayton Blehm became one of the co-owners and helped the company rise to its success. However, in 2002, Blehm was terminated from the company.

Who was the founder of DC Shoes?

DC Shoes. DC Shoe Co. was founded in 1993 by Ken Block and Damon Way as a footwear extension of Droors Clothing, hence the name DC Shoes. DC Shoes established itself early through their progressive styles and an elite skate team.
